Colorado Rockies first baseman Mark Reynolds clubbed his 12th home run of the season Tuesday as the Rockies beat the Chicago Cubs 10-4 in the first half of a split doubleheader.
Reynolds finished the game 3-for-4 with three runs scored and three RBI's as he continued his red-hot start to the season. The 11-year veteran has been found gold for the Rockies so far as they signed Reynolds to a $1.5 million minor league deal this offseason.
Reynolds owns .336 average with a 1.081 OPS, 12 home runs, and 30 RBI's in 128 plate appearances.
